The Science of Inattentional Blindness

Why do some viewers see a clear detail while others see nothing at all? The answer often lies in inattentional blindness. This psychological phenomenon occurs when an individual fails to perceive an unexpected stimulus in plain sight because their attention is focused elsewhere. When a video is edited to highlight a specific detail, the viewer’s brain often “tunes out” the surrounding environment. If the visual cue is subtle—such as a slight movement in the background or a frame-by-frame color shift—the brain may simply categorize it as background noise.

Key Factors Influencing Perception

  • Cognitive Load: If a viewer is scrolling quickly, their brain is in “scanning mode,” making it harder to process complex visual data.
  • Expectation Bias: Viewers often look for what they expect to see based on the video’s caption or title, causing them to ignore contradictory visual evidence.
  • Screen Quality and Compression: Social media algorithms frequently compress video files. High-frequency details can be lost in the pixelation, rendering subtle visual cues invisible on mobile screens.

Why Viral Content Thrives on Ambiguity

Content that leaves users confused is often the most successful at driving engagement. When a viewer comments, “I watched this six times and don’t see anything,” they aren’t just expressing frustration; they are inadvertently boosting the video’s algorithmic performance. Platforms like TikTok, Reddit, and Instagram prioritize posts with high comment volume, regardless of whether the sentiment is positive or confused.

Creators often lean into this by producing “rage-bait” or “confusion-bait” content. By omitting the obvious or framing a shot to be intentionally obscure, they force the viewer to re-watch the clip multiple times. Each loop counts as a view, and each comment asking for clarification signals to the platform that the content is “engaging,” pushing it further into the feeds of new users.

How to Better Analyze Fast-Paced Media

If you find yourself struggling to spot the hidden details in viral clips, you can apply a few journalistic techniques to break through the digital noise:

  1. Slow Down the Playback: Most modern video players allow for 0.5x speed. This reduces the cognitive load and allows your eyes to track movement that happens in milliseconds.
  2. Change Your Focus Point: Instead of looking at the center of the screen, scan the periphery. Often, the “secret” is hidden in the corners where the eye is least likely to look.
  3. Check the Community Consensus: Before spending excessive time analyzing a clip, check the top comments. Frequently, other users have already performed a frame-by-frame analysis and identified the timestamp of the event in question.
